Exploitation and Injustice Continue: The Fate of Migrant Workers in Post-World Cup Qatar

Qatar: Six Months Post-World Cup, Migrant Workers Suffer June 16, 2023 10:30AM EDT [Beirut] – Six months after the 2022 World Cup final in Doha, FIFA and Qatari authorities have failed to provide compensation for widespread abuses, including wage theft and unexplained deaths of migrant workers who prepared and delivered […]
